Видео по теме

How to Pass Data from Child to Parent in React Interview #shorts #javascript #react #interview

JavaScript - Полный Курс JavaScript Для Начинающих [11 ЧАСОВ]

Введение в сценарии JavaScript

JavaScript стал неотъемлемой частью веб-разработки, позволяя создавать динамичные и интерактивные элементы на сайтах. В этой статье мы рассмотрим лучшие сценарии JavaScript, которые могут значительно улучшить ваш проект. Ознакомьтесь с идеями и примерами кода, чтобы сделать вашу разработку более эффективной и интересной.

Полезные сценарии JavaScript

1. Создание выпадающего меню

Выпадающее меню — это отличный способ организовать навигацию на сайте. Вот пример простого сценария:

const menuToggle = document.querySelector('.menu-toggle'); const menu = document.querySelector('.menu'); menuToggle.addEventListener('click', () => { menu.classList.toggle('active'); });

2. Слайдер изображений

Слайдер изображений позволяет показать несколько изображений в ограниченном пространстве. Вот простой пример реализации:

let currentIndex = 0; const slides = document.querySelectorAll('.slide'); function showSlide(index) { slides.forEach((slide, i) => { slide.style.display = (i === index) ? 'block' : 'none'; }); } document.querySelector('.next').addEventListener('click', () => { currentIndex = (currentIndex + 1) % slides.length; showSlide(currentIndex); }); showSlide(currentIndex);

3. Валидация форм

Валидация форм помогает предотвратить ошибки при вводе данных пользователями. Вот пример простого сценария валидации:

const form = document.querySelector('form'); form.addEventListener('submit', (e) => { const email = form.querySelector('input[type="email"]').value; if (!validateEmail(email)) { e.preventDefault(); alert('Введите корректный email!'); } }); function validateEmail(email) { const re = /^[^\s@]+@[^\s@]+\.[^\s@]+$/; return re.test(email); }

Заключение

Сценарии JavaScript могут значительно улучшить функциональность ваших проектов. Используя приведенные примеры, вы сможете добавить интерактивные элементы на свой сайт и сделать его более привлекательным для пользователей. Не забывайте экспериментировать и адаптировать сценарии под свои нужды!

Похожие записи

Рекомендации

Куда поступить на фронтенд разработчика: лучшие учебные заведения и программы обучения
Куда поступить на фронтенд разработчика: лучшие учебные заведения и программы обучения В статье рассматриваются лучшие учебные заведения и программы обучения для желающих стать фронтенд разработчиками. Узнайте, куда поступить, чтобы получить качественное образование и востребованную профессию в IT.
Создайте бесплатное приложение для сайта за несколько минут!
Создайте бесплатное приложение для сайта за несколько минут! Создайте приложение для своего сайта бесплатно всего за несколько минут! Удобный конструктор поможет вам быстро реализовать идеи и улучшить взаимодействие с пользователями, не требуя навыков программирования.
Лучшие фронтенд фреймворки 2023 года: выбери идеальный инструмент для своего проекта
Лучшие фронтенд фреймворки 2023 года: выбери идеальный инструмент для своего проекта В нашем обзоре лучших фронтенд фреймворков 2023 года вы найдете идеальные инструменты для разработки веб-приложений, которые помогут улучшить производительность и упростить процесс создания интерфейсов.
Работы на себя для начинающих: как начать зарабатывать самостоятельно уже сегодня
Работы на себя для начинающих: как начать зарабатывать самостоятельно уже сегодня Узнайте, как начать зарабатывать самостоятельно, используя свои навыки и увлечения. Мы предлагаем советы и идеи для начинающих, чтобы вы могли выбрать подходящие работы на себя и начать зарабатывать уже сегодня.
Скачайте фреймворк с официального сайта - начните свой проект уже сегодня!
Скачайте фреймворк с официального сайта - начните свой проект уже сегодня! Скачайте фреймворк с официального сайта и начните свой проект уже сегодня! Удобный инструмент поможет вам реализовать идеи быстро и эффективно, предоставляя все необходимые ресурсы для успешной разработки.

Python Разработка Flask

Python: Веб-разработка (Flask) от «Хекслета» — курс, включающий 24 урока с тестовыми и практическими заданиями, который поможет освоить веб-разработку на Python с использованием Flask. Веб-разработчик. Они про­во­дят необ­хо­ди­мые настрой­ки, созда­ют и под­клю­ча­ют API-клю­чи, настра­и­ва­ют без­опас­ность и обес­пе­чи­ва­ют пол­но­цен­ное вза­и­мо­дей­ствие с дру­ги­ми сер­ви­са­ми. В случае с Гугл, это @gmail.com. Онлайн-сервис предлагает большой выбор шаблонов, дизайнерских шрифтов и цветовых палитр для создания лендингов и веб-сайтов. Это как тот кот, который и жив, и мертв. Какие-то представляли собой платформы, обучающие всему подряд, какие-то были чересчур игровыми и не выглядели серьёзно, а некоторые - и вовсе не вызывали доверия. Примеры работ. https://www.nimax.ru/heime/ https://www.nimax.ru/gsom/ https://www.nimax.ru/6seasons_site/ https://www.nimax.ru/netwell/ https://www.nimax.ru/gamedev/ https://www.nimax.ru/copycat/ Отзывы о студии Nimax. Для этого переходите в свой аккаунт на рег.ру , в правом верхнем углу кликаете на логин, выбираете «Домены и услуги», в строке с именем вашего сайта нажимаете три точки, выбираете «DNS-серверы», затем «Свой список DNS-серверов» и вносите DNS, полученные у хостера. Такой сайт будет полностью готов к приему трафика и его конвертированию в реальную пользу. сценарии javascript

Продажа Может Быть

Продажа может быть прямой и непрямой. Как часто нужно обновлять сайт? Этот ресурс хорош тем, что вы можете быстро освежить знания о какой-нибудь легкой ерунде, которая часто забывается. Преимущества языка: — Ruby для людей: язык создан для удобства разработчиков. Как и при регистрации, воспользуйтесь кнопкой «Войти». 2. Необходимые экзамены для поступления. Среда разработки, работающая в браузере. Перед тем, как создать загрузочную флешку с операционной системой Windows на борту, потребуется ее подготовить. Как видно из таблицы, наличие бесплатного сертификата безопасности, возможность подключить аналитику на сайт, добавить ключевые слова для SEO-оптимизации страницы и настроить интеграцию с дополнительными сервисами — базовые функции, которые есть практически в каждом конструкторе. Программист искусственного интеллекта должен продемонстрировать интервьюеру знания в области алгоритмов ИИ и Deep Learning, опыт работы с нейронными сетями и их оптимизацией, навыки анализа Big Data, понимание принципов оценивания и интерпретации моделей. сценарии javascript

Senior Специалиста Важно

Для senior-специалиста важно также думать о дальнейшей карьере . Сколько стоит создание сайта в 2025 году: полное руководство. ИИ генерирует сайт. Биохимик Фронтенд-разработчик. Чем функциональнее ресурс, тем выше цена; Используемые технологии. Кубковый рейтинг SMM-агентств 2025. Как создать учетную запись iCloud в России: пошаговая инструкция. Сразу скажу, что обучение не для слабонервных, но те, кто доживают до конца - обладают неплохими начальными навыками. Чтение специализированной литературы и участие в профессиональных конференциях. Обучение рассчитано на 12 месяцев. сценарии javascript

Если Удалось Дойти

Если вам удалось дойти до оффер-интервью, считайте это победой. При этом основная его задача – предоставить разработчику удобные синтаксические конструкции для упрощения и ускорения разработки. Какие теги HTML важно знать новичку. Другие разработчики увидят их и смогут принять, если они понравятся. Узнать больше. Другие программы от Практикум. Выносим функционал в блюпринты Наследование шаблонов Создаем свой декоратор. Разработчик веб и мультимедийных приложений - что это за профессия такая? Нажмите «Добавить аккаунт». Это поможет вам продемонстрировать свои навыки, общаться с другими разработчиками и создавать профессиональные связи.